Afghanistan continues to be ranked as the unhappiest country in the world, according to the World Happiness Report 2026, which measures a country's happiness based on its gross domestic product, social support and personal freedom.

Afghanistan consistently holds the lowest spot (146th out of 146) in the annual UN-sponsored report.

Reports suggest that the denial of education and employment opportunities for women in Afghanistan, under Taliban rule, has led to a global increase in the mental stress of the country's population.

Afghanistan is followed by Sierra Leone and Malawi. Sierra Leone struggles with poverty, political instability, and the aftermath of civil war continue to affect the quality of life.

In Malawi, high poverty rates, food insecurity, and limited access to healthcare and education contribute to widespread unhappiness.

Next in the list is Zimbabwe, which faces hyperinflation, political instability, and widespread poverty, all of which severely impact the happiness of its citizens.

Following closely is Botswana, where high inequality and limited access to healthcare and education contribute to the challenges affecting the nation's overall well-being.
